Output 89beee63f10c19b64305335e05695f53d7b1a9f3f091f09e7c77cb5734c90606:0

value
2625872
script pubkey
OP_HASH160 OP_PUSHBYTES_20 95ebf83630a0046739dfc9501cbf502b032f72de OP_EQUAL
address
3FMjHabmrGZ1FZCi7LMRj7acrkrkkjXpHv
transaction
89beee63f10c19b64305335e05695f53d7b1a9f3f091f09e7c77cb5734c90606
spent
true